| Seattle Gay News teams with Purr for Oscar party |
Unless Marion Cotillard and Ruby Dee score upset wins, the winners of the 2008 Academy Awards are as predictable as John McCain's trip to Minneapolis-St. Paul in September. But that doesn't mean you have to skip the fun of watching the glitzy ceremony this year, which enjoys a last-minute polish thanks to the recent end to the writers' strike.
Seattle Gay News is once again proud to host an Oscar Party at Purr Cocktail Lounge (1518 11th Avenue) with all the fixin's: prizes, drink specials, film goodies, red carpet, and mounted flatscreens to view the event - from the limousine arrivals to the acceptance speech for Best Picture.
The Oscar Party is February 24, starting at 4 p.m. No cover charge. No cost for entering our pick-the-winners contest. Plus, the comfort of watching the awards in an upbeat, festive environment that welcomes everyone.
